Postby irlmin » Sat Mar 17, 2007 9:41 pm

A brilliant day In Fermoy and even the weather was good !! . Kevin Ring had a good start to the day organised with some serious food and Tea and Coffee even before We started , Thanks for that Kevin it was really appreciated . We had 24 Minis of all ages and types in the Parade and had a really good reaction from the crowd , after the Parade was over We had a short run and then Home . another successful MCOI event .
